RAIN THE WINNER IN AN INTRIGUING MATCH
 
Kings CC vs. Surrey Cryptics CC
Sunday 16th May 2010
Match drawn
 
In what was Kings first actual home game of the season saw them entertain new opponents in Surrey Cryptics. With disappointing weather once again coming on a sunday the match was played in conditions less than ideal with scattered showers being an unwelcome addition to a cool day. In a time game the visitors once the toss and elected to bowl first. Kings were missing talented batsmen Perry, Warne and Miah, whilst short of bowling with the likes of Sones, Gale, Daye and the aforementioned Miah and Warne all unavailable
 
The opening overs saw the bowlers dominate as Nihill and Edwards found some movement off both the pitch and in the air. Despite conceeding 11 runs in his first two overs Edwards then reeled off three maidens, whilst Nihill gave up just four runs in as many overs. With the ball popping off the pitch Nihill brought in a short leg, and makeshift opener and Vice Captain Paul Bygrave in trying to ensure the close fielder did not come into play opted for the off side but ended up offering a tame catch to cover (16-1) By the 10th over King had just 17 runs on the board and Nihill had the impressive figures of 1 for 4 off 6 overs. Edwards was rested and replaced by Grindrod. The next wicket was self inflicted as Miller pulled a short pull straight to square leg, who fumbled but recovered well to shy at the stumps at the bowlers end and Millers run on the miss field proved to be ill fated when the throw hit direct (30-2). Nangle's miss timed shot saw him pick out a fielder as he was dismissed for his first duck for Kings  (40-3) The scoring had ground to a halt as Grindrod reeled off 7 overs for the cost of just a single run, whilst also picking up the wicket of Melligan, caught behind first ball after the drinks break (40-4). After 22 overs Kings had these 40 runs on the board and with all the top four batsmen dismissed. However there was a mini revival as Wright and Pipe started to break free but Grindrod picked up his second wicket when Wright was caught (63-5). Things started to improve for Kings when Pipe was joined by Mears, with some fine runing mixed with some good boundaries, Pipe driving well and Mears as usual putting the sweep to good use, saw the score past the 100 mark in the 35th over. However Mears was adjudged leg before to Cupit (108-6) and despite a couple of well struck boundaries Tighe fell shortly after (117-7). The rapid accleration Kings really needed followed when Pipe was joined by Inwood - these two when on an aggressive assault of the bowling, the first over from the returning Nihill going for 13 runs - compared to the 13 conceeded in his previous 8 overs. Some lusty blows from Pipe seemed to be taking him to a well deserved half century, unfortunately he edge Nihill behind and fell two runs short (140-8). More quick runs followed from Inwood, before in trying to manufacture a single, he reverse swept Seeckts into the point fielders hands (148-9). Skipper Young and last man Smith took the score to 156 before the rain became to heavy to continue. Tea was taken, the covers put in place and the innings resumned afterwards but it took only 3 balls for Nihill to wrap the innings up. The final score of 156, even given the conditions, looked 30 runs short of par, but thanks to Pipe and the other middle order Kings at least had something to defend, which had look very unlikely after 30 overs.
 
The Cyrptics response got off to a reasonable start, as Wright opened up by taking 7 off Tighe's first over, however the opending overs saw the Kings bowlers dominate. Inwood was particularly hostile and gave both Wright and Hogben a good test. Tighe was unfortunate, beating the bat or seeing both batsmen dangerously working the ball off middle stump to behind square. The first wicket should have come when Wright skied Inwood to mid on but Young failed to hold the chance. However it was a short lived reprieve as rising ball from Inwood saw Wright flash at the ball and Smith took a good catch behind, two balls later Benham (who had made a century the weekend before) had his off stump laid back as Inwood returned 2-3 off 5 overs. The pressure on the Cryptics batsmen did not relent as Tighe now found the groove in reeling off four maidens in a row, and with the pressure came the next wicket as Jurek drove Tighe to extra cover where Young made amends for his earlier error by taking a good catch. Inwood struck again when he finally removed Hogben to had dug deep to see out 16 overs for his 7 runs. When Pipe replaced Tighe, and struck in his first over, bowling Espejo Kings had the visitors in all sorts of trouble. However Cupit and Grindrod stood firm and started to play some agressive shots as the bowlers struggle to keep control in the rain. Soon the rain started to get a lot heavier and with the pitch now starting to suffer there was little option but to call time on the game with Cryptics at 58-5 and 16 overs remaining.
 
Arguably Kings could have said they should have gone on to win the game, however with less than 100 runs needed the visitors would have surely given a good fist of chasing the runs down, ultimately the elements were the winner in a game which twist and turned.
